Siemens and SuperTrak CONVEYANCE™, specialist in linear conveyor technology, have announced a new strategic alliance to maximize product range, machine throughput and reduce cycle times for engineering and manufacturing customers.

The two companies have joined forces to offer the market an intelligent conveyor system that can be installed as conveying technology on production machines and also integrated into the TIA Portal. The carriers are driven by linear motors and move flexibly between stations during the production process.

The SuperTrak Horizon3™ enclosed magnetic conveying system enables manufacturers to create high-performance, cost-efficient and space-saving machine designs. By combining the mechatronics system with the motion control capabilities of Simatic controllers and Siemens’ TIA Portal, all components work seamlessly together to help machine builders realize the optimal conveying solution.

Siemens Xcelerator: Reducing engineering complexity for machine builders

Combining Siemens’ hardware and software solutions from the Siemens Xcelerator portfolio with the SuperTrak CONVEYANCE™ system yields a fully integrated, demand-oriented conveyance solution. The closed-loop linear transport system offers a variety of layout options. It’s designed for smaller payloads and products and can carry up to three kilograms per shuttle. The carrier pitch is reduced to a minimum size of 50 millimeters, allowing objects to be handled at high speed in a much closer range to achieve high throughput numbers, which are required by packaging customers.

Connecting the SuperTrak CONVEYANCE™ platform with the Siemens TIA Portal and integrating it in the Simatic S7-1500T controller allows users to easily implement synchronized motion tasks with additional motion-control axes by using real-time communication. Each shuttle can be controlled independently through the use of technology objects in TIA Portal. Technology objects enable different motion sequences, such as grouping of multiple shuttles or clamping a product between two shuttles for a filling process.

A 3D simulation and animation of the system’s production process and shuttle workflow provides machine builders with valuable insights into the ideal layout of the system, required shuttle numbers, and throughput figures.
